About pubX

pubX builds next-generation agentic advertising infrastructure. Our AI makes real-time, revenue-critical decisions for digital publishers and advertisers. We've priced over 1 trillion programmatic auctions, we're ranked #5 globally in the Prebid Analytics Adapter Rankings, and we're a founding member of AgenticAdvertising.org.

The Problem We're Solving

Publishers and advertisers leave significant revenue on the table because ad sales are still largely manual, static, or rule-based. Every campaign is unique, but most campaign management systems lack the intelligence to evaluate context, demand, and deal potential in real time.

Why This Role Exists

We're building the infrastructure for agentic advertising: AI agents that sit on both sides of a media transaction, taking a buyer's brief through to a live, publisher-approved campaign with minimal manual work.
This role exists to take real ownership of a piece of that system. You'll take a defined area from discovery through delivery and iteration, with clear accountability for the roadmap decisions, the trade-offs, and whether it actually works once it's live.

The Role

You'll own a defined area of Agentic Advertising end-to-end: framing the problem, scoping the MVP, working directly with engineering to build it, and staying accountable for it once it's live. You'll be in the detail with engineering day-to-day.
This work is already running with real advertisers and publishers, and the standards underneath it are still being written. Cycles are short and what you ship reaches live campaigns quickly.
You'll work closely with the rest of the product team, engineering, and commercial teams.

What You'll Do

  • Lead end-to-end discovery and delivery for your area of Agentic Advertising
  • Frame problems clearly and validate them through user research and data
  • Define MVP scope, success criteria, and iteration plans
  • Prioritise work based on impact, effort, and learning, and be explicit about what you're not doing
  • Work day-to-day with engineering to unblock delivery
  • Use AI to increase the speed and quality of your own discovery and delivery work, while holding a high bar for accuracy and data sensitivity
  • Support launches and adoption with Sales and Customer Success

What Success Looks Like (First 6 Months)

  • At least one meaningful capability shipped end-to-end from discovery through launch, with instrumentation in place and at least one change made on the back of what it told you
  • A focused, outcome-driven roadmap for your area: priorities, trade-offs, and what you're deliberately not doing and the reasons why
  • Engineering trusts you to scope your area's work accurately
  • Strong working relationships across product, engineering, and commercial

What We're Looking For

Must-have

  • 5+ years product management experience shipping B2B SaaS products, where you defined the problems worth solving rather than delivering against a roadmap set elsewhere
  • Experience in AdTech / programmatic, ideally with exposure to the buy side, sell side, or both
  • Experience running discovery and scoping MVPs under real constraints, ideally without much supporting infrastructure (design, research, data) to lean on
  • Excellent written and verbal communication — able to make a case to technical and non-technical audiences without losing the nuance
  • Comfort using data to define and evaluate success, and knowing when the data doesn't answer the question
  • Pragmatic product judgment and a bias toward outcomes
  • A demonstrated habit of using AI to improve day-to-day product work

Nice-to-have

  • Experience with technical products involving APIs, agents, or data integrations
  • Familiarity with agent protocols or agentic workflows (AdCP or similar)
  • Experience shipping AI-powered features or products

How We Hire

  1. CV & profile review
    We look at relevant experience and background to confirm fit before moving forward.
  2. Initial chat (45 mins)
    A conversation about motivation, role fit, and a deeper dive into your experience.
  3. Live task interview (60 mins)
    A live exercise testing product thinking and problem-solving in practice, not just in theory.
  4. Final interview (60 mins)
    A behavioural interview covering how you think, how you work, your technical and commercial judgement, and whether we're the right fit for each other.
